Nearly 900 Refugees Returned to Syria from Jordan and Lebanon in Recent Days
Nearly 900 Syrian refugees have returned to the Syrian Arab Republic from Jordan and Lebanon in recent days. This was reported by RIA Novosti, citing the Russian center for reconciliation of conflicting parties and monitoring of the movements of refugees.
“In the past day, 889 refugees returned to Syria from abroad, including from Lebanon (125 women, 213 children) and from Jordan (142 women, 241 children),” the statement said.
According to the center's data, the engineering units of the Syrian armed forces have cleared 1.8 hectares of land in one day, and specialists have destroyed 27 explosive devices.
